The Opportunity

We're looking for a Pavement Surfacing Engineer to help shape the future of South Australia's roads. In this role, you'll develop asphalt specifications, check construction quality, and make sure projects meet the right standards.

You'll work closely with suppliers and contractors to improve practices and drive innovation. You'll also provide technical advice on pavement design and condition assessments, keep clear records, and help manage risks. This is your chance to make a real impact on the safety and quality of our transport network.

About you

You're an experienced engineer who really knows asphalt mix registration and compliance. You're confident developing and reviewing asphalt specs, using research and industry feedback to get the best results. You work well with suppliers and contractors, bringing people together to drive innovation and consistency.

You're skilled in flexible pavement design, using mechanistic-empirical methods and tools like CIRCLY. Whether working solo or as part of a team, you manage your time well, make informed decisions under pressure, and deliver on deadlines. You communicate clearly at all levels, resolve conflicts calmly, and build strong, positive relationships.
